Six Arrested during Theft Complaint Investigation in Southeast Kentucky

six arrests

LONDON, KY - Laurel County Sheriff John Root is reporting that: Laurel Sheriff's Detective Taylor McDaniel along with Major Chuck Johnson, Lieut. Chris Edwards, Detective James Sizemore, and Detective Bryon Lawson arrested six individuals on Wednesday morning April 7, 2021 at approximately 10:39 AM.

The arrests occurred off old KY 30 near East Bernstadt while Sheriff's detectives and deputies were investigating a theft complaint on Highway 3094 near East Bernstadt. Sheriff's investigators found suspects in possession of a stolen welder, ladder, and air compressor.

In addition, suspects were located with outstanding warrants.
